Hey bratacos

Please print out or copy this page to Notepad in order to assist you when carrying out the following instructions.

Rename Hijackthis:

1. Locate the program Hijackthis.
2. Select the file, right-click and select Rename.
3. Please change the name to: jamielaw
4. Then please could you post a new Hijackthis log.

Vundo Fix:

Please download VundoFix.exe to your desktop
  • Double-click VundoFix.exe to run it.
  • Click the Scan for Vundo button.
  • Once it's done scanning, click the Remove Vundo button.
  • You will receive a prompt asking if you want to remove the files, click YES
  • Once you click yes, your desktop will go blank as it starts removing Vundo.
  • When completed, it will prompt that it will reboot your computer, click OK.
  • Please post the contents of C:\vundofix.txt in your next reply.
Note: It is possible that VundoFix encountered a file it could not remove. In this case, VundoFix will run on reboot, simply follow the above instructions starting from "Click the Scan for Vundo button" when VundoFix appears upon rebooting.

Update Java:

Your version of Java is now outdated. Java vulnerabilites are commonly exploited by viruses so I strongly recommend you update. Click here to download the latest version of java ( Java Runtime Environment (JRE) 5.0 Update 9 ). Please install it and then reboot your computer.

Remove the older versions of Java:
  • Click Start, Control Panel, Add/Remove Programs.
  • Delete all Java updates except J2SE Runtime Environment 5.0 Update 9
